    1. Symptoms of fever in dogs

    1.Temperature: The normal body temperature for dogs is generally between degrees. The puppy temperature is slightly warmer and can be measured with a thermometer. If the temperature is too high, you will have a fever.

    2.Psychological state: The dog's psychological state will become sluggish when it has a fever, and if the dog has been lying on its stomach and cannot move normally, the body should be in a state of discomfort.

    3.Appetite: A dog with a fever is unwell and its appetite will decrease, if you find that the dog is not interested in food, lick it once or twice and leave, then you should pay attention to whether the dog is sick.

    4.Changes in the tip of the nose: If the dog is unwell, the tip of the nose will change. The general tip of the nose should be a little wet, you can touch the tip of the nose to see the situation.

    Second, the best way to get a fever in dogs

    1.Physical cooling.

    When a dog has a fever, we can use physical cooling to avoid the heat damaging their nerves. You can use a damp towel to wipe your dog's body.

    2.Hydrate. When a dog has a fever, the owner must give the dog enough water because high fever can easily cause dehydration. If the dog does not want to drink on its own, it can be filled with water with a syringe.
